What's everyone's opinion about a succinct explanation: "The block was clean, the body was not."?
Quote:
Originally Posted by Nevadaref View Post
I think it's a terrible reason to call a foul and even worse as an explanation to a coach or player. If all of the people in the gym can see that the ball was blocked cleanly, calling a foul for body contact is not going to be accepted.
I agree with Nevada on this. I think that is a bad explanation.

If you work a lot of boy's basketball and this is a common call, then I think you will get run out of that level quickly. This is really the case when you have really tall and physical players that will have opponents bounce off of them on a regular basis. Maybe that works with girl's basketball (as I do not call those games), but on the boy's side this will get you killed.
